Total Cost of Ownership — Electric vs Petrol Scooter
- Initial Purchase: Electric scooter models can have a competitive upfront cost, often offset by long-term savings. Petrol scooter prices vary widely, with similar initial investments.
- Daily Running Cost: Electric scooter charging at home results in a meaningfully lower per-kilometre cost. Petrol scooter running costs fluctuate directly with fuel prices.
- Maintenance Expenses: Electric scooters typically require fewer scheduled service visits due to simpler drivetrains. Petrol scooters demand routine engine maintenance, including oil changes and filter replacements.
- Residual Value: Both types of scooters hold value, but the evolving EV market suggests strong long-term demand for electric models with robust battery health.
- Long-term Economics: Over typical multi-year horizons, long-term ownership economics often favour electric scooters due to lower operational expenses.

Maintenance & Service Burden
The maintenance profile of an electric scooter differs significantly from a petrol scooter, generally leading to a reduced service burden. A petrol scooter's complex engine requires regular oil changes, spark plug replacements, air and fuel filter cleaning, and periodic tune-ups to ensure optimal performance. In contrast, an electric scooter features a much simpler drivetrain with fewer moving parts. This translates into fewer scheduled service visits, lower overall maintenance costs, and less downtime.
